I would suggest a simple test. Change the color from settings (blue for example), turn ignition off, wait until red led on navi turns off, turn the key to position 1 and if the color is changed to default (some kind of brown), the flash memory is corrupted for sure and there is no way to reflash it.
I have 4 units with problem like this. |
